I can confirm this problem for the standard Ubuntu alternate install
disk as well.

The problem is that that installer pauses at 85% throught to download
packages. Since my network connection to my router was active (but not
to the outside internet) the installer did not know that it cannot find
sources packages.

My solution was to physically remove the network cables so that the
machine had no network connection whatsoever and setup the network after
the installation had completed.

It would be nice to have a message to the user which told them what is
going on during the install.
